Overview

Radar Chart displays multiple dimensions of data in a web-like chart so you can compare how each indicator performs as part of the whole. It is useful for multi-factor evaluation, performance comparison, and side-by-side review in a spreadsheet.

Core capabilities:

  • Insert a radar chart from the Insert tab after selecting a data range.
  • Choose a radar chart subtype, including a standard radar chart or a radar chart with data markers.
  • Move and resize the chart after it is created.
  • View chart updates with collaborators in collaboration mode.
